from .internals import (
layer_collections,
rto_history,
copy_buffer,
swap_buffer,
)
rto_path = {
"exclude": "exclude",
"select": "collection.hide_select",
"hide": "hide_viewport",
"disable": "collection.hide_viewport",
"render": "collection.hide_render"
}
def get_rto(layer_collection, rto):
if rto in ["exclude", "hide"]:
return getattr(layer_collection, rto_path[rto])
else:
collection = getattr(layer_collection, "collection")
return getattr(collection, rto_path[rto].split(".")[1])
def set_rto(layer_collection, rto, value):
if rto in ["exclude", "hide"]:
setattr(layer_collection, rto_path[rto], value)
else:
collection = getattr(layer_collection, "collection")
setattr(collection, rto_path[rto].split(".")[1], value)
def apply_to_children(laycol, apply_function):
laycol_iter_list = [laycol.children]
while len(laycol_iter_list) > 0:
new_laycol_iter_list = []
for laycol_iter in laycol_iter_list:
for layer_collection in laycol_iter:
apply_function(layer_collection)
if len(layer_collection.children) > 0:
new_laycol_iter_list.append(layer_collection.children)
laycol_iter_list = new_laycol_iter_list
def isolate_rto(cls, self, view_layer, rto, *, children=False):
laycol_ptr = layer_collections[self.name]["ptr"]
target = rto_history[rto][view_layer]["target"]
history = rto_history[rto][view_layer]["history"]
# get active collections
active_layer_collections = [x["ptr"] for x in layer_collections.values()
if not get_rto(x["ptr"], rto)]
# check if previous state should be restored
if cls.isolated and self.name == target:
# restore previous state
for x, item in enumerate(layer_collections.values()):
set_rto(item["ptr"], rto, history[x])
# reset target and history
del rto_history[rto][view_layer]
cls.isolated = False
# check if all RTOs should be activated
elif (len(active_layer_collections) == 1 and
active_layer_collections[0].name == self.name):
# activate all collections
for item in layer_collections.values():
set_rto(item["ptr"], rto, False)
# reset target and history
del rto_history[rto][view_layer]
cls.isolated = False
else:
# isolate collection
rto_history[rto][view_layer]["target"] = self.name
# reset history
history.clear()
# save state
for item in layer_collections.values():
history.append(get_rto(item["ptr"], rto))
child_states = {}
if children:
# get child states
def get_child_states(layer_collection):
child_states[layer_collection.name] = get_rto(layer_collection, rto)
apply_to_children(laycol_ptr, get_child_states)
# isolate collection
for item in layer_collections.values():
if item["name"] != laycol_ptr.name:
set_rto(item["ptr"], rto, True)
set_rto(laycol_ptr, rto, False)
if rto != "exclude":
# activate all parents
laycol = layer_collections[self.name]
while laycol["id"] != 0:
set_rto(laycol["ptr"], rto, False)
laycol = laycol["parent"]
if children:
# restore child states
def restore_child_states(layer_collection):
set_rto(layer_collection, rto, child_states[layer_collection.name])
apply_to_children(laycol_ptr, restore_child_states)
else:
if children:
# restore child states
def restore_child_states(layer_collection):
set_rto(layer_collection, rto, child_states[layer_collection.name])
apply_to_children(laycol_ptr, restore_child_states)
else:
# deactivate all children
def deactivate_all_children(layer_collection):
set_rto(layer_collection, rto, True)
apply_to_children(laycol_ptr, deactivate_all_children)
cls.isolated = True
def toggle_children(self, view_layer, rto):
laycol_ptr = layer_collections[self.name]["ptr"]
# reset exclude history
del rto_history[rto][view_layer]
if rto == "exclude":
laycol_ptr.exclude = not laycol_ptr.exclude
else:
# toggle selectability of collection
state = not get_rto(laycol_ptr, rto)
set_rto(laycol_ptr, rto, state)
def set_state(layer_collection):
set_rto(layer_collection, rto, state)
apply_to_children(laycol_ptr, set_state)
def activate_all_rtos(view_layer, rto):
history = rto_history[rto+"_all"][view_layer]
# if not activated, activate all
if len(history) == 0:
keep_history = False
for item in reversed(list(layer_collections.values())):
if get_rto(item["ptr"], rto) == True:
keep_history = True
history.append(get_rto(item["ptr"], rto))
set_rto(item["ptr"], rto, False)
if not keep_history:
history.clear()
history.reverse()
else:
for x, item in enumerate(layer_collections.values()):
set_rto(item["ptr"], rto, history[x])
del rto_history[rto+"_all"][view_layer]
def invert_rtos(rto):
for x, item in enumerate(layer_collections.values()):
set_rto(item["ptr"], rto, not get_rto(item["ptr"], rto))
def copy_rtos(rto):
if not copy_buffer["RTO"]:
# copy
copy_buffer["RTO"] = rto
for laycol in layer_collections.values():
copy_buffer["values"].append(get_rto(laycol["ptr"], rto))
else:
# paste
for x, laycol in enumerate(layer_collections.values()):
set_rto(laycol["ptr"], rto, copy_buffer["values"][x])
# clear copy buffer
copy_buffer["RTO"] = ""
copy_buffer["values"].clear()
def swap_rtos(rto):
if not swap_buffer["A"]["values"]:
# get A
swap_buffer["A"]["RTO"] = rto
for laycol in layer_collections.values():
swap_buffer["A"]["values"].append(get_rto(laycol["ptr"], rto))
else:
# get B
swap_buffer["B"]["RTO"] = rto
for laycol in layer_collections.values():
swap_buffer["B"]["values"].append(get_rto(laycol["ptr"], rto))
# swap A with B
for x, laycol in enumerate(layer_collections.values()):
set_rto(laycol["ptr"], swap_buffer["A"]["RTO"], swap_buffer["B"]["values"][x])
set_rto(laycol["ptr"], swap_buffer["B"]["RTO"], swap_buffer["A"]["values"][x])
# clear swap buffer
swap_buffer["A"]["RTO"] = ""
swap_buffer["A"]["values"].clear()
swap_buffer["B"]["RTO"] = ""
swap_buffer["B"]["values"].clear()
def clear_copy(rto):
if copy_buffer["RTO"] == rto:
copy_buffer["RTO"] = ""
copy_buffer["values"].clear()
def clear_swap(rto):
if swap_buffer["A"]["RTO"] == rto:
swap_buffer["A"]["RTO"] = ""
swap_buffer["A"]["values"].clear()
swap_buffer["B"]["RTO"] = ""
swap_buffer["B"]["values"].clear()
